Course Overview
Human Resource Management plays an important and strategic role in managing people and the workplace culture and environment. Individuals in this position will deal with issues related to compensation, performance management, as well as organisation development, safety and wellness. A career in this field will provide you with the opportunity to influence innumerable aspects of an organisation, to assist in the development of its employment, and play a crucial part in influencing strategic business decisions. Admission Criteria
- Passed the KCSE with an aggregate of C +
- A minimum grade of C in English and Mathematics

Detailed course information
CHRP 1 (6 Months)
- Introduction to Human Resource Management
- Business Communication
- Business Law
- Introduction to Financial Accounting
- Principles and Practice in Management
Candidates will be required to undertake a workplace attachment to provide them with an opportunity for firsthand experience on the activities undertaken in a HRM Department. The workplace attachment will be undertaken at the end of the CHRP I course.
